Harris and Hardy combine for 39 in Women's Basketball's 83-76 loss to Southern Nevada

YUMA, Ariz. – The No. 14 ranked Arizona Western Matadors Women's Basketball team (13-2, 4-1) suffered its first conference loss of the season on Saturday afternoon in North Las Vegas, Nev., losing 83-76 to College of Southern Nevada (13-3, 3-2) at CSN Coyote Event Center.

Dyvine Harris scored 20 points to lead all scorers as the Matadors fell to the Coyotes, snapping 10 10-game winning streak.

The Matadors came out strong, hitting three three-pointers in the first two minutes, scoring 11 of the first 15 points to take an 11-4 lead. College of Southern Nevada battled back to tie the game at 18-18 before Harris gave the Matadors the lead back with a three-pointer. The Coyotes answered the Harris three with one of their own to send the game to the second quarter knotted at 21-21.

College of Southern Nevada held the Matadors to just eight points in the second quarter, being outscored 21-8. Nyah Hardy was able to stop an early 7-0 run with a made three-pointer before doing so again to cut the Coyotes' lead to 34-29 before Southern Nevada closed the first half with an 8-0 run to take a 42-29 lead into the break.

After trailing 56-42 in the third quarter, the Matadors were able to cut the deficit to six points at 56-50 thanks to a 6-0 run, capped off by a Rita Gomes three-pointer. College of Southern Nevada built the lead back up to 10 points at 64-54.

The Coyotes jumped out to an 81-63 lead midway through the fourth quarter and the Matadors were able to climb back to within six points but ran out of time, falling 83-76.

Nyah Hardy finished the game as the Matadors' second-leading scorer, scoring 19 points off the bench while Rita Gomes scored 14 points and Naomy Zonzon-Huyghe ended the game with 11.
